Ordinals
beta
Address 1EC7dxzFfpbK9mtHuUE4C9rQ1kPsRuR1QY
sat balance
96849
runes balances
outputs
7a5883410ab1473a0bb3e75a2d17efa50e309979130542d0ad51ef79a43e680c:1